domingo, 25 de diciembre de 2011

Cuenta Corriente / Liquidación de Haberes

I - Liquidación Individual









Genera Planilla Genera  el Cuenta Corriente de un funcionário considerando de esta forma:

La base para la liquidacion es una consulta con las columnas: chofer, mes, fecha, descripcion, documento, debe, haber, tipo
 
En la version original  se obtienen "lineas" de 3 fuentes
Salario        >>  valor_salario  - historico_cargas   -
Comisiones >>  cteviagem_valores - historico_cargas - planviagem
Vales          >>  lancamento   - notalancamento   -   historico
En otras situaciones, para buscar valores en otras fuentes se usará el archivo auxiliar sql_liquida.txt en el cual se guardará una SQL que deberá generar las mismas lineas y contará con estos parámetros:

#0 columna 1 -  funcionario
#4 columna 2 - periodo de pago
#1 filtro para comisiones                
#2 filtro para descuentos
en caso se incluya el salario  utilizando la tabla auxiliar valor_salario
#3 funcionario
#5 fecha


Para "generar las linas" se estabelece un filtro de acuerdo con los
parametros que se informan

1-actualiza en valor_salario, leyendo desda la BD sueldos (Recibos Oficiales)
  campos: historico, motorista, fecha, valor_comissao
  con:    1, F.codigo, Fecha final del periodo,
       (salario_contratual - (salario_contratual/30*faltas))

2-establece filtros para generar la lineas deseadas (periodo / funcionario)

    2.1     Para los valores generados por cualquier concepto
    2.1.1  código del  funcionario en el  campo  planilla.Motorista
    2.1.2 periodo de acuerdo con un parametro que podra asumir los siguiente valores:
       Dia Final          fecha de llegada en la planilla de viajes
       P-MM             mes indicado en la  planilla
       P-MMAA        mes y año ( con 2 digitos) indicados en la  planilla
       P-MMAAAA   mes y año ( con 4 digitos) indicados en la  planilla
       C-MM             mes indicado en la  planilla
       C-MMAA       mes y año ( con 2 digitos) indicados en la  planilla
       C-MMAAAA  mes y año ( con 4 digitos) indicados en la  planilla

    2.2    Para los descuentos  que se generan de los vales u otras entregas al funcionario

    2.2.1 código del  funcionario en el  campo lancamento.auxiliar
    2.2.2 periodo de acuerdo campo   notalancamento.data  en el intervalo indicado
    2.2.3 eventos y cuentas contables   indicados en el parámetro   CondHistoricosDebito
            donde se establece una condición con cualquier campo de la tabla lancamento

            ejemplos
            and ( L.conta <> 261 and ( ( historico = 112)   or ( historico = 10)) or ( L.conta = 27 and   historico = 902) )
                    and ( L.conta = 19   and ( ( historico = 112) ) or ( L.conta = 22 and   historico = 902) )
                    and ( historico = 10 or historico= 112 or historico = 114 ))


Habiendo efectuado esta selección  copia estas informaciones a la tabla  BOMBA, generando las columnas: chofer, mes, fecha, cc, docto, debe, haber, tp.
Si ya hubiesen registros para ese funcionario en el periodo, solo continua con la confirmación del usuario, caso en el cual los registros existentes en BOMBA serán eliminados antes del registro de las nuevas lineas.


Ejecuta la accion Rehacer Consulta, la cual recompone el saldo que se obtiene de total de haberes - total de descuentos.


Es posible efectuar cambios (incluir, modificar valores o conceptos) en la planilla presentada, los cuales quedan registrados en la tabla BOMBA. ( Caso se generne nuevamente la planilla estos cambios serán perdidos).


Las faltas que se informen en esta ventana quedan grabadas en el sistema de sueldos.



Imprime usando la plantilla  CtaCorriente.rtm y exporta a c:\CtaCorriente.xlsx




II - APORTES 
Al entrar a la ventana Aportes el sistema presenta  una planilla con los aportes (Leyes Sociales) calculados en el sistema de sueldos, los cuales vienen marcados con uns S.  
Aquí es posible:


Marcar  o  desmarcar las lineas (todas o una) .


Incorporar Aportes de un Funcionario
Busca en recibos de sueldos los valors correspondientes a Leyes Sociales (rubro_empresa > 9000) , y los registra en la tabla BOMBA, substituyendo anteriores si los hubiere para ese funcionario / periodo.


Incorporar Aportes de todos los Funcionarios


Exportar a Excel


III - Retenciones 
Busca en recibos de sueldos los valors correspondientes a Leyes Sociales ( rubro_empresa = 1100 ) , y los registra en la tabla BOMBA, substituyendo anteriores si los hubiere para ese funcionario / periodo.


IV - Liquidación General 
Consulta, imprime o graba en Excel una planilla con el resumen de haberes,descuentos y saldo por funcionario, de todos los que se hizo una planilla individual




Imprime usando la plantilla     LiqGeneral.rtm, exporta a c:\LiqGeneral.xlsx


No hay comentarios:

Publicar un comentario en la entrada